Polycarboxylate Ethers: The Next Generation of Superplasticizers
Polycarboxylate compounds are quickly emerging as the next type of high-range water reducers in the construction sector . Traditionally , lignosulfonates held this niche, but PCEs provide significant benefits , including lower water content , improved placeability of concrete , and better durability of the finished structure . Moreover , PCEs exhibit better blending with a range of additives and allow for precise modification of cement properties .

The Way Superplasticizers Improve Concrete Workability and Strength
Superplasticizers function as highly effective admixtures incorporated in concrete blends to significantly improve flowability. Originally , concrete often required substantial amounts of water to achieve a placeable consistency, which inherently reduced its ultimate load-bearing capability . However, superplasticizers permit for a substantial reduction in water content whereas maintaining, and often increasing , the fresh concrete’s consistency . This dual benefit produces a denser final product exhibiting improved performance to cracking and greater overall lifespan .
The Science Behind Polycarboxylate Ether Superplasticizers
The mechanism of polycarboxylate ether modifiers depends on a sophisticated molecular design. These compounds possess side chains modified with carboxylate groups, which exhibit a unique potential to bind onto aggregate grains. This adsorption creates spatial hindrance, inhibiting aggregate agglomeration and allowing the creation of highly fluid cementitious compositions. The extent and density of these side chains immediately affect the dispersion effectiveness and the liquid requirement of the final mixture, providing enhanced workability compared to conventional superplasticizers.
